%X The current study aimed to propose a grouping method by archipelagos to define the domain andjurisdiction of sedimentary islands located in the Estuarine-Lagoon Complex of Iguape and Cananéia,Southeastern Brazil, in order to minimize the impacts resulting from human action and obtain futureenvironmental funds. For this purpose, the Voronoi Diagram was used, with the help of the geographicinformation system gvSIG, a free open source software. The studied section is about 65 km long, between theRibeira de Iguape River mouth and the Cananéia mouth, located to the north and south of the study area,respectively. A total of 51 islands was found in the Mar Pequeno, comprising an area of 5.040.175,00 m2. TheVoronoi was useful for the delimitation of the alveo, where three municipalities have jurisprudence: Cananéia,Iguape and Ilha Comprida. This fact was particularly important, once from the delimitation of the alveo it waspossible to group the islands into archipelagos and thus define the area belonging to each of the municipalities.The results obtained may be useful for the territorial planning of the study area, especially in an estuarinecomplex where human action and environmental dynamics exert a strong influence on the landscape. The usedmethodology can be applied in other estuarine regions along the Brazilian coast, in order to help to define thedomains of islands and archipelagos.
